The year 2024 will be marked by the appearance of an important model for Renault with the new electric R5. Its presentation should take place at the end of 2023, so the French manufacturer is slowly but surely starting to provide some information about its model.

Even if it lacks numbers at the moment, Renault does offer a few tidbits regarding the car’s architecture, as well as its engine and battery.

Renault 5 electric: platform

So, let’s start with the element that will surprise us the least: the platform. Unsurprisingly, the diamond firm confirms that its R5 will be based on the famous CMF, on which most of the products of the Renault-Nissan-Mitsubishi alliance are based, be they thermal, hybrid or electric. The electric Renault 5 will be the basis variant CMF-B EVintended for electric models of segment B.

The brand clarifies that this platform provides versatility and flexibility, in particular a significant reduction in costs. Renault has also taken a cue from the Zoé, as thanks to the optimization of certain elements, the manufacturer manages to save up to 30% in production costs compared to the Zoé.

There is also a surprise the presence of a multi-lever rear axletechnology so rare for B-segment cars. This technical choice is now commonplace among several high-end manufacturers for driving dynamics reasons, and Renault has chosen this system to move towards greater “fun to drive” according to him.

Electric Renault 5: engine

For the engine, Renault chose a synchronous unit with a rotating rotor, as in the Zoé and Mégane E-Tech. This engine is devoid of permanent magnets and rare earth elements, which allows you to save on its production, as well as increase the weight by about 20 kg.

If Renault has not yet released the figures, several sources mention power from 120 to 150 hpas well as up to more than 200 hp. for the famous Alpine version, which will arrive by 2025.

Renault 5 electric: battery

As for batteries, yes status quo, since, as with the engine, the diamond mark does not give numbers. On the other hand, we already know that it will be a new battery in the range, with a simplified architecture and 12-module routing, like the Zoé battery, with four large modules, which allows to reduce the weight by 15 kg. The package should also be relatively thin, with Renault announcing that there will only be one level of modules with better energy density.

As for the battery capacity, it is not yet known, but according to our information, Renault should offer two capacities: 40 and 52 kWh. The smaller battery should have a range of just over 300 km, compared to around 420 for the larger one.

Renault 5 electric: price and availability

The electric Renault 5 will be produced from 2024 at the Cléon plant in Normandy. Production is expected to begin in the fall of the same year.

In terms of price, Renault hasn’t put forward any prices yet, although we already know that the price of the car should start just below 25,000 eurosexcluding environmental bonus.
